What is a synonym for issues?

The best synonym for "issues" depends on the context. Here are some options:

General:

* Problems: This is a common synonym for issues, particularly when referring to difficulties or challenges.

* Matters: This is a more formal synonym, often used in professional contexts.

* Concerns: This emphasizes the importance or urgency of the issues.

* Topics: This focuses on the subject matter being discussed.

* Subjects: Similar to topics, this emphasizes the specific areas being addressed.

More specific:

* Disputes: If the issues are disagreements or conflicts.

* Challenges: If the issues are obstacles to overcome.

* Obstacles: Similar to challenges, this emphasizes the hindrances presented.

* Debates: If the issues are being discussed or argued over.

* Questions: If the issues are unclear or need to be resolved.

Informal:

* Troubles: This is a more casual synonym for problems.

* Hurdles: This emphasizes the difficulties that need to be overcome.

* Gripes: This refers to complaints or grievances.

The best synonym to use will depend on the specific context and the nuance you want to convey.
